Abstract
This paper proposes an embedded ITS system for V2V andV2I communications. The proposed system adopts WAVE technology to provide a safety service for a fast moving vehicle and transportation. WAVE specification is designed to minimize the packet latency by simplifying the call connection steps and operating multi-channel switching scheme. The proposed embedded ITS system is implemented and tested under various test conditions. The throughput results showed around 5.6 Mbps between two devices. The test results will verify that WAVE will be a solution for a vehicle safety service because of low PER and latency.
